Author: veithen
Date: Tue Oct 23 15:54:09 2018
New Revision: 1844666
URL: http://svn.apache.org/viewvc?rev=1844666&view=rev
Log:
Upgrade JAXB and JAX-WS.
Modified:
axis/axis2/java/core/trunk/modules/distribution/src/main/assembly/bin-assembly.xml
axis/axis2/java/core/trunk/modules/jaxbri-codegen/pom.xml
axis/axis2/java/core/trunk/modules/jaxws/pom.xml
axis/axis2/java/core/trunk/modules/metadata/pom.xml
axis/axis2/java/core/trunk/pom.xml
Modified:
axis/axis2/java/core/trunk/modules/distribution/src/main/assembly/bin-assembly.xml
URL:
http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/modules/distribution/src/main/assembly/bin-assembly.xml?rev=1844666&r1=1844665&r2=1844666&view=diff
==============================================================================
---
axis/axis2/java/core/trunk/modules/distribution/src/main/assembly/bin-assembly.xml
(original)
+++
axis/axis2/java/core/trunk/modules/distribution/src/main/assembly/bin-assembly.xml
Tue Oct 23 15:54:09 2018
@@ -188,7 +188,6 @@
<exclude>com.sun.xml.fastinfoset:FastInfoset:jar</exclude>
<exclude>rhino:js:jar</exclude>
<exclude>javax.servlet:servlet-api</exclude>
- <exclude>javax.xml.ws:jaxws-api:jar</exclude>
<exclude>com.sun.xml.messaging.saaj:saaj-impl:jar</exclude>
<exclude>com.sun.xml.stream:sjsxp:jar</exclude>
<exclude>com.sun.org.apache.xml.internal:resolver:jar</exclude>
Modified: axis/axis2/java/core/trunk/modules/jaxbri-codegen/pom.xml
URL:
http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/modules/jaxbri-codegen/pom.xml?rev=1844666&r1=1844665&r2=1844666&view=diff
==============================================================================
--- axis/axis2/java/core/trunk/modules/jaxbri-codegen/pom.xml (original)
+++ axis/axis2/java/core/trunk/modules/jaxbri-codegen/pom.xml Tue Oct 23
15:54:09 2018
@@ -48,8 +48,8 @@
<scope>test</scope>
</dependency>
<dependency>
- <groupId>com.sun.xml.bind</groupId>
- <artifactId>jaxb-impl</artifactId>
+ <groupId>org.glassfish.jaxb</groupId>
+ <artifactId>jaxb-runtime</artifactId>
</dependency>
<dependency>
<groupId>com.sun.xml.bind</groupId>
Modified: axis/axis2/java/core/trunk/modules/jaxws/pom.xml
URL:
http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/modules/jaxws/pom.xml?rev=1844666&r1=1844665&r2=1844666&view=diff
==============================================================================
--- axis/axis2/java/core/trunk/modules/jaxws/pom.xml (original)
+++ axis/axis2/java/core/trunk/modules/jaxws/pom.xml Tue Oct 23 15:54:09 2018
@@ -62,14 +62,8 @@
<artifactId>xml-resolver</artifactId>
</dependency>
<dependency>
- <groupId>com.sun.xml.bind</groupId>
- <artifactId>jaxb-impl</artifactId>
- <exclusions>
- <exclusion>
- <artifactId>jsr173</artifactId>
- <groupId>javax.xml</groupId>
- </exclusion>
- </exclusions>
+ <groupId>org.glassfish.jaxb</groupId>
+ <artifactId>jaxb-runtime</artifactId>
</dependency>
<dependency>
<groupId>com.sun.xml.bind</groupId>
Modified: axis/axis2/java/core/trunk/modules/metadata/pom.xml
URL:
http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/modules/metadata/pom.xml?rev=1844666&r1=1844665&r2=1844666&view=diff
==============================================================================
--- axis/axis2/java/core/trunk/modules/metadata/pom.xml (original)
+++ axis/axis2/java/core/trunk/modules/metadata/pom.xml Tue Oct 23 15:54:09 2018
@@ -56,14 +56,8 @@
<artifactId>xml-resolver</artifactId>
</dependency>
<dependency>
- <groupId>com.sun.xml.bind</groupId>
- <artifactId>jaxb-impl</artifactId>
- <exclusions>
- <exclusion>
- <artifactId>jsr173</artifactId>
- <groupId>javax.xml</groupId>
- </exclusion>
- </exclusions>
+ <groupId>org.glassfish.jaxb</groupId>
+ <artifactId>jaxb-runtime</artifactId>
</dependency>
<dependency>
<groupId>junit</groupId>
Modified: axis/axis2/java/core/trunk/pom.xml
URL:
http://svn.apache.org/viewvc/axis/axis2/java/core/trunk/pom.xml?rev=1844666&r1=1844665&r2=1844666&view=diff
==============================================================================
--- axis/axis2/java/core/trunk/pom.xml (original)
+++ axis/axis2/java/core/trunk/pom.xml Tue Oct 23 15:54:09 2018
@@ -529,8 +529,8 @@
<httpcore.version>4.4.6</httpcore.version>
<httpclient.version>4.5.3</httpclient.version>
<intellij.version>5.0</intellij.version>
- <jaxb.api.version>2.2.6</jaxb.api.version>
- <jaxbri.version>2.2.6</jaxbri.version>
+ <jaxb.api.version>2.3.1</jaxb.api.version>
+ <jaxbri.version>2.3.1</jaxbri.version>
<jettison.version>1.3.8</jettison.version>
<jibx.version>1.3.1</jibx.version>
<log4j.version>1.2.15</log4j.version>
@@ -554,8 +554,8 @@
<failIfNoTests>false</failIfNoTests>
<m2Repository>'${settings.localRepository}'</m2Repository>
<geronimo-spec.jta.version>1.1</geronimo-spec.jta.version>
- <jaxws.tools.version>2.2.6</jaxws.tools.version>
- <jaxws.rt.version>2.2.6</jaxws.rt.version>
+ <jaxws.tools.version>2.3.1</jaxws.tools.version>
+ <jaxws.rt.version>2.3.1</jaxws.rt.version>
<jsr311.api.version>1.1.1</jsr311.api.version>
<!-- This variable is used in some Xdocs and is substituted using
Velocity. Note that
@@ -606,8 +606,8 @@
<version>1.2.0</version>
</dependency>
<dependency>
- <groupId>com.sun.xml.bind</groupId>
- <artifactId>jaxb-impl</artifactId>
+ <groupId>org.glassfish.jaxb</groupId>
+ <artifactId>jaxb-runtime</artifactId>
<version>${jaxbri.version}</version>
</dependency>
<dependency>
@@ -619,16 +619,6 @@
<groupId>javax.xml.bind</groupId>
<artifactId>jaxb-api</artifactId>
<version>${jaxb.api.version}</version>
- <exclusions>
- <exclusion>
- <groupId>javax.xml.stream</groupId>
- <artifactId>stax-api</artifactId>
- </exclusion>
- <exclusion>
- <groupId>javax.activation</groupId>
- <artifactId>activation</artifactId>
- </exclusion>
- </exclusions>
</dependency>
<dependency>
<groupId>javax.xml.soap</groupId>
@@ -644,24 +634,6 @@
<groupId>com.sun.xml.ws</groupId>
<artifactId>jaxws-rt</artifactId>
<version>${jaxws.rt.version}</version>
- <exclusions>
- <exclusion>
- <groupId>javax.xml.stream</groupId>
- <artifactId>stax-api</artifactId>
- </exclusion>
- <exclusion>
- <groupId>javax.activation</groupId>
- <artifactId>activation</artifactId>
- </exclusion>
- <exclusion>
- <groupId>javax.xml.soap</groupId>
- <artifactId>saaj-api</artifactId>
- </exclusion>
- <exclusion>
- <groupId>com.sun.xml.messaging.saaj</groupId>
- <artifactId>saaj-impl</artifactId>
- </exclusion>
- </exclusions>
</dependency>
<dependency>
<groupId>org.springframework</groupId>